use RTCD pointer for intra4x4_predict
authorJohann <johannkoenig@google.com>
Tue, 31 Jul 2012 21:12:32 +0000 (14:12 -0700)
committerJohann <johannkoenig@google.com>
Wed, 1 Aug 2012 17:48:29 +0000 (10:48 -0700)
Change-Id: I4161389ff02aa37636540ac0fe0fe9763d52ebdc

vp8/common/reconintra4x4.c
vp8/common/rtcd_defs.sh
vp8/decoder/decodframe.c
vp8/decoder/threading.c

index dcc35ec..f35e719 100644 (file)
@@ -300,9 +300,9 @@ void vp8_intra4x4_predict_c(unsigned char *src, int src_stride,
 {
     unsigned char *Above = src - src_stride;
 
-    vp8_intra4x4_predict_d_c(Above,
-                             src - 1, src_stride,
-                             b_mode,
-                             dst, dst_stride,
-                             Above[-1]);
+    vp8_intra4x4_predict_d(Above,
+                           src - 1, src_stride,
+                           b_mode,
+                           dst, dst_stride,
+                           Above[-1]);
 }
index 0805ede..6651a3a 100644 (file)
@@ -145,6 +145,8 @@ prototype void vp8_build_intra_predictors_mbuv_s "struct macroblockd *x, unsigne
 specialize vp8_build_intra_predictors_mbuv_s sse2 ssse3
 
 prototype void vp8_intra4x4_predict_d "unsigned char *above, unsigned char *left, int left_stride, int b_mode, unsigned char *dst, int dst_stride, unsigned char top_left"
+# No existing specializations
+
 prototype void vp8_intra4x4_predict "unsigned char *src, int src_stride, int b_mode, unsigned char *dst, int dst_stride"
 specialize vp8_intra4x4_predict media
 vp8_intra4x4_predict_media=vp8_intra4x4_predict_armv6
index 677e222..1694b48 100644 (file)
@@ -199,7 +199,7 @@ static void decode_macroblock(VP8D_COMP *pbi, MACROBLOCKD *xd,
                 left_stride = dst_stride;
                 top_left = yabove[-1];
 
-                vp8_intra4x4_predict_d_c(yabove, yleft, left_stride,
+                vp8_intra4x4_predict_d(yabove, yleft, left_stride,
                                        b_mode,
                                        base_dst + b->offset, dst_stride,
                                        top_left);
index 3749583..4d12b3a 100644 (file)
@@ -205,7 +205,7 @@ static void mt_decode_macroblock(VP8D_COMP *pbi, MACROBLOCKD *xd,
                 else
                     top_left = yabove[-1];
 
-                vp8_intra4x4_predict_d_c(yabove, yleft, left_stride,
+                vp8_intra4x4_predict_d(yabove, yleft, left_stride,
                                        b_mode,
                                        base_dst + b->offset, dst_stride,
                                        top_left);